Packaging Engineering Lead (Clinton, IN Manufacturing Site)

Job Description:

Responsibilities
  • Serve as site packaging owner, providing technical leadership across packaging platforms (bags, blisters, bottles, cartons) while managing packaging‑related projects and supporting supplier selection, testing, and qualification.
  • Develop and maintain packaging specifications for primary, secondary, and tertiary components, ensuring compliance with Regulatory Commitment Documents (RCD) and supporting artwork changes with accurate dimensional templates.
  • Ensure packaging compliance by applying global quality standards, supporting international shipping requirements (including DG/UN), completing annual product review inputs, and staying current on evolving FDA, CVM, and environmental regulations.
  • Lead packaging quality investigations (deviations, complaints, and change controls) using strong root‑cause methodologies and effective corrective/preventive actions.
  • Drive continuous improvement in safety, cycle time, inventory accuracy, and packaging performance by identifying hazards, supporting lean/OEE improvement projects, and participating in supplier audits.
